Key
Responsibilities - Build and maintain a practical reliability program spanning hardware, electrical systems, firmware-enabled systems, production processes, and field feedback. - Use reliability block diagrams and FMECA to identify single-point failures, cascading effects, and high-risk dependencies across vehicle architectures. - Recommend specific component, subsystem, environmental, and screening tests based on failure hypotheses and mission risk. - Lead root cause investigations using teardown, test data, manufacturing records, and field evidence. - Establish lightweight failure-reporting and corrective-action workflows that drive design, test, and production changes at the pace the program demands. - Decide what reliability work must happen now, what can stay lightweight, and what can be deferred while communicating residual risk. - Partner cross-functionally with design, test, manufacturing, quality, suppliers, and field operations to close reliability gaps.
